CQC Certification Reveals: ‘Power Bank’ Level Battery

The CQC database listing confirms that the Honor X80 comes with a 10,000mAh (typical capacity) battery, rated at 9,755mAh. This Li-ion polymer battery will deliver 39.1Wh of energy at 3.91V, comparable to the power of the Steam Deck LCD. With 5G support, the phone will also manage battery drain during high-speed connectivity. Compared to the Honor X70, this upgrade sets a new standard in the mid-range segment, where most phones operate with 5,000-6,000mAh batteries. Leaks suggest the 80W fast charging will recharge the battery quickly, eliminating the need for frequent charging. Specs Explosion: Full Package from Display to Camera

According to leaks, the Honor X80 will feature a 6.8-inch FHD+ AMOL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ate and 1.5K resolution. The LTPS panel will have rounded corners, ideal for video streaming and gaming. It is expected to be powered by the Snapdragon 7 Gen 4 or 7s Gen 4 chipset, paired with 8/12GB RAM and 128/256/512GB storage options for smooth multitasking. The camera setup will include a dual rear camera with a 108MP primary sensor and an 8MP front selfie camera, enhanced with AI features to appeal to content creators. IP66/IP68/IP69 ratings ensure water and dust resistance. Overall, this package offers strong value for money in the mid-range segment.

Launch in China, Global Debut in 2026

The Honor X80 is expected to launch in China around December 2025 or January 2026, as indicated by CQC approval. It is likely to reach global markets by early 2026, including India, the USA, and the UK. Following the Honor X70’s pattern, the phone will debut in China first, followed by an international rollout. Markets such as Japan and France, with high demand for battery-focused devices, are also expected to see a prompt entry. While there is no official date yet, certification signals are strong.
